Role Description
This is a full-time on-site role for a Behavioral Therapist LCSW/LCSW-A located in Charlotte, NC. The Behavioral Therapist will provide therapeutic services using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) and other therapeutic strategies. Daily tasks include conducting behavior assessments, developing and implementing therapy plans, and providing support to individuals and their families. The role requires collaborating with a multidisciplinary team to ensure comprehensive care and progress tracking for each individual.

Qualifications
- Expertise in Applied Behavior Analysis and Behavior Analysis
- Strong Interpersonal Skills for effective communication and collaboration
- Knowledge of Psychology principles and practices
- Experience working with children is essential
- Proficiency in developing and implementing personalized therapy plans
- Master's degree in Social Work or a related field
- Current LCSW or LCSW-A licensure in North Carolina
- Ability to work effectively in a team environment and independently
- Experience with I/DD and mental health populations is a plus
